Open source UI @drobinetm/multitabs
Live demo

React

A real instance of @drobinetm/multitabs-react running with react-router-dom using MemoryRouter so it doesn't affect the page URL. Navigate the links inside the shell to open, close, and reorder tabs. The demo mounts as a client:only="react" island because the shell depends on router state and browser storage.

← Back to React docs
React review lab

Edge-case sandboxes

Focused states for overflow, tab limits, long titles, resolveTab(), and custom slots. Each sandbox runs independently with MemoryRouter and its own storage key.